Chesterton Primary School Catchment Area Information

As an academy, Chesterton Primary School sets its own admissions criteria, agreed with Wandsworth. The catchment area boundary is defined in the school's annual admissions policy, which may differ from the LA's general school admissions arrangements.

Currently oversubscribed: 424 pupils enrolled against a capacity of 420 places. Living within the catchment area is especially important for this school.

The official admissions policy — including the catchment boundary map — is published by Wandsworth before each admissions cycle. Always verify your address with the council before submitting an application, as boundaries can change year to year.

Frequently Asked Questions — Chesterton Primary School

Is Chesterton Primary School oversubscribed?

Yes — Chesterton Primary School currently has 424 pupils enrolled against a capacity of 420 places. Catchment area proximity is an important admissions criterion when applying.

What is the admissions policy for Chesterton Primary School?

Admission to Chesterton Primary School is managed by Wandsworth. When oversubscribed, places go to looked-after children first, then siblings, then catchment area distance. Always verify the current policy with the council before applying.

What age range does Chesterton Primary School cover?

Chesterton Primary School is a primary school in London, Wandsworth, serving pupils aged 3–11. For the latest information, visit the school's website or the DfE Get Information About Schools service.

What is the Ofsted rating for Chesterton Primary School?

Chesterton Primary School was rated Outstanding by Ofsted in 2023. Full inspection reports are available at reports.ofsted.gov.uk.
